From: Gabor Marton Date: Mon, 3 Sep 2018 13:10:53 +0000 (+0000) Subject: [ASTImporter] Merge ExprBits X-Git-Url: https://granicus.if.org/sourcecode?a=commitdiff_plain;h=66c9a415739c7dc685fdd40f855322dea8c69a0f;p=clang [ASTImporter] Merge ExprBits Summary: Some `Expr` classes set up default values for the `ExprBits` of `Stmt`. These default values are then overwritten by the parser sometimes. One example is `InitListExpr` which sets the value kind to be an rvalue in the ctor. However, this bit may change after the `InitListExpr` is created. There may be other expressions similar to `InitListExpr` in this sense, thus the safest solution is to copy the expression bits. The lack of copying `ExprBits` causes an assertion in the analyzer engine in a specific case: Since the value kind is not imported, the analyzer engine believes that the given InitListExpr is an rvalue, thus it creates a nonloc::CompoundVal instead of creating memory region (as in case of an lvalue reference).
